PhotoPut lets you capture a photo or video and send it straight to a specific Google Drive folder — before it ever touches your gallery. Perfect for teachers, contractors, property managers, or anyone who works across multiple contexts and needs photos organised from the moment they're taken.
How it works
1. Set up roles — name them, pick a colour and icon, connect your Google account, and choose a Drive folder
2. Open PhotoPut, tap a role, and take your photo
3. Done. The file uploads to the right place automatically
Features
- Named roles with custom colours, icons, and background images for instant recognition
- Direct upload to Google Drive — files go exactly where you need them
- Automatic dated subfolders (multiple format options)
- Custom file labels for easy searching later
- Offline queue — capture now, upload when you have signal
- Background retry — failed uploads are retried automatically
- Local files deleted only after successful upload — nothing is ever lost
- Works as a system camera app — launch PhotoPut from Android's camera shortcut or any "take photo" prompt

Privacy first
No accounts, no analytics, no tracking. Your photos go from your device to your Google Drive — nothing passes through our servers. PhotoPut requests only the minimum Drive permission needed and cannot see or modify any files it didn't create.
